Known simply as "green cap", this classic Aussie ale is dry and pleasantly hoppy, with a fruity malt palate (banana and toffee). This beer is sedimented, and can either be drunk clear or cloudy.

Bag loads of whole Chinook and Cascade hop flowers as well as some local flowers from Tasmania are thrown at this beer, creating an intense citrus and grapefruit aroma and flavour balanced with a careful selection of specialty malts and a local pale malt. Preservative and additive free Pale Ale is live-yeast conditioned in bottles. From brewing to release, a batch of pale ale takes about six weeks, allowing for two weeks conditioning in the bottle No artificial additives are included, just great ingredients.

Two types of malted barley are used in West Coast Ale including a fair proportion of crystal barley. Cascade and Northern Brewer hops are used to make four separate hop additions to the boil to ensure that the right balance of aroma and bitterness is in this 5% ABV beer. An initial rich aroma of biscuity malt is complemented by the spicy character of the hop. The beer pours clear with an intense ruby-red / brown colour and a well developed head that produces a lace-work pattern on the glass as the beer is drunk. The beer is medium bodied, and smooth on the palate which is initially dominated by characteristic crystal malt flavours and then followed by a well balanced hop character in both aroma and a pleasant fruity, or spicy, hop palate.

Durban Pale Ale was inspired by the original IPA’s produced in Britain and then shipped to India for consumption by the soldiers and bureaucrats.Cascade hops provide bitterness, Challenger hops provide the crisp, fruity characteristic of the beer,which is complimented by a special strain of English ale yeast used to ferment the beer. The beer is a light caramel colour, with an immediate blast of rich orange on the nose, a toffee character and just a hint of spice from the cascade hops. On the palate it is medium- to full-bodied, and the initial sweetness from the sheer amount of barley in this beer is balanced with solid and tangy hops and a gentle fruitiness with a dry after-taste.

A full flavoured, strong double India Pale Ale, hopped with Amarillo, Citra and Nelson Sauvin. This beer has a pale straw-amber body, and pours with a full creamy head. Its complex flavours include mandarin orange, schnapps, pineapple, and juicy tropical fruits. It is warmingly alcoholic with a dry finish.
